The mysterious interstellar object 3I/ATLAS is approaching Earth , captivating astronomers and the public alike. Discovered in July 2025, 3I/ATLAS is the third object identified as originating from outside our solar system. It is expected to make its closest approach to Earth on December 19, coming within approximately 167 million miles, or about 1.5 times the distance from Earth to the Sun.

NASA's Hubble Space Telescope has been observing 3I/ATLAS since its discovery, capturing detailed images of the comet. These observations have confirmed that the object is traveling on a hyperbolic orbit, which will eventually take it out of the solar system.
